Serbia - Traffic of Passenger Trains with Diesel Locomotives
In 2019, the country was ranked number 15 among other countries in Traffic of Passenger Trains with Diesel Locomotives at 82 Thousand Train-Kilometers. Serbia is overtaken by Slovenia, which was ranked number 14 with 105 Thousand Train-Kilometers and is followed by Portugal at 0 Thousand Train-Kilometers. Sweden lead the ranking with 5,637 Thousand Train-Kilometers in 2019, +10.5% versus 2018. Hungary, Turkey and Czech Republic resp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Poland witnessed the best average annual growth at +23.8% per year, while Macedonia was the worst growing country at -22.2% per year.
